Sequence diversity of the 1.3 kb retron (retron-Ec107) among three distinct phylogenetic groups of Escherichia coli.
Molecular microbiology - 1 Feb 1992
Kawaguchi T, Herzer P J, Inouye M, Inouye S
Abstract excerpt
In the preceding paper, we showed that a new 1.3 kb retron (retron-Ec107) in Escherichia coli is responsible for the biosynthesis of a branched-RNA-linked multicopy single-stranded DNA (msDNA-Ec107). Here, we show that this retron occurs in strains from different branches, A, B1, and D of a well-defined phylogenetic tree of a collection of wild E. coli.
